    Abstract: An organic light emitting display apparatus includes a substrate including a plurality of pixels. The organic light emitting display apparatus further includes a plurality of organic light emitting diodes on the substrate so as to correspond to the plurality of pixels. The plurality of pixels includes a first pixel, a second pixel, a third pixel, and a fourth pixel which emit different color light. Each of the plurality of organic light emitting diodes includes a first electrode, a light emitting portion on the first electrode and a second electrode on the light emitting portion. A thickness of the first electrode of the first pixel is different from a thickness of the first electrode of the second pixel, and the thickness of the first electrode of the second pixel is different from a thickness of the first electrode of the third pixel.

    Abstract: A semiconductor device including a first contact plug structure on a substrate, a lower spacer structure on a sidewall of the first contact plug structure, and a bit line structure on the first contact plug structure and including a conductive structure and an insulation structure stacked in a vertical direction substantially perpendicular to an upper surface of the substrate may be provided. The first contact plug structure may include a conductive pad contacting the upper surface of the substrate, an ohmic contact pattern on the conductive pad, and a conductive filling pattern on the ohmic contact pattern. The conductive filling pattern may include metal, and include a lower portion having a relatively large width and an upper portion having a relatively small width. The lower spacer structure may contact a sidewall of the conductive filling pattern.

    Abstract: It is provided a novel LLC resonant converter with high reliability and the operation method thereof. The LLC resonant converter proposed in the present invention includes an original converter including a primary side circuit on which two half-bridge cells are connected in parallel and a secondary side circuit on which two half-bridge cells are connected in series and a redundant converter having the same configuration with the original converter, and connected with the original converter at a midpoint of a secondary winding.
